About TCNJ

Founded in 1855, TCNJ offers a highly personalized and collaborative liberal arts education with over 7,400 undergraduates and 700 graduate students. The college is consistently ranked among the top comprehensive colleges in the nation, offering small classes, a 13:1 student-faculty ratio, and an immersive living-learning experience. With a 4-year graduation rate ranked #1 in New Jersey and #9 among U.S. public institutions, TCNJ is a model for public higher education.

Position Overview

This position will be responsible for supporting clinical mental health graduate students in identifying and securing clinical experiences for practicum and internship as well as supporting apprenticeship students. This involves building a robust network of clinical sites both within and outside of the state of New Jersey by positively representing the Department with our partners. As the primary support for field-placed students, the Clinical Coordinator must provide a nurturing and positive presence and have exceptional organizational skills.

Because clinical experiences occur year round during the fall, spring, and summer terms, the clinical coordinator must be a disciplined professional capable of maintaining high standards of coordination in a virtual environment.

Essential work includes:

- The Clinical Coordinator will coordinate all clinical experiences and respond to all inquiries from students, faculty, administrators, and external professionals regarding the clinical program.

- Overseeing ongoing, systematic CACREP assessments, curricular evaluation, and program improvement efforts within the department to be included in the CACREP annual report as it related to student clinical experiences.

- Monitoring apprenticeship progress and communicating with apprenticeship partners.

Responsibilities Clinical Coordinator functions
  • Mentors students to help find their practicum/internship sites immediately upon enrollment in the program
  • Recruits potential sites to accept interns, both in NJ and nationally.
  • Supervises student progress in practicum, internship, and apprenticeship through oversight of the Supervision Assist platform.
  • Manages all site affiliation agreement contracts related to field placements (including apprenticeships)
  • Answers inquiries from potential apprenticeship and internship sites.
Apprenticeship functions
  • Assists with monitoring the apprenticeship data, this includes sending out forms to supervisors, monitoring completion requirements, and reporting.
  • Ensures timely submission of progress reports to apprenticeship partners.
Clinical Coordinator functions
  • Hosts 2-3 clinical Practicum orientations each year to introduce students who will soon be eligible to start their clinical experience to the requirements associated with starting their Practicum and with completing the paperwork necessary to select their site.
  • Schedules and oversees the pre-practicum skills assessment of students, coordinates related hiring.
  • Provides or coordinates a minimum of two continuing education opportunities to site supervisors per term.
  • Maintains the Clinical Manual, including the development of revisions associated with changes in the codes of ethics, accreditation standards and legislation relevant to the profession and each potential license for our students.
  • Oversees ongoing, systematic CACREP assessments and accreditation report writing as related to clinical experiences. Prepares for and writes the sections of the CACREP-accreditation reports pertaining to the clinical experiences of our students in both Practicum and Internship.
